Franking his form

By Casey O'Connor

As we have reported in Spin over the past few months Warwick golfer Clayton Frank has been in amazing touch since his recent return to the game and Warwick club competition after a lengthy break from the game.

There was certainly no change in his form of the past few weeks in last Saturday’s single stableford event at the Warwick Golf Club.

His run of form has been nothing short of amazing and on Saturday a score of 41 points saw him finish a shot clear of runner up Aaron Osborne as he added another Saturday competition to his recent tally.

Keith Clarke and John Urwin each recorded 39 points while Evan Pfeffer (37), David Craggs and Kris McLennan (both on 35) rounded out the run down.

The pro pin went to Keith Clarke collected four balls. Kris McLennan and Anthony Seidl each won two balls and Michael Hoskin added another ball to his collection. T round out a good day Clarke also held the pin at the seventh. Peter Darton did best at the ninth to win the pin for that hole. He is a relatively new member who shows a lot of promise. The pin shot at the 11th went the way of Josh Keer while Mal Galla held the pin shot at the 16th pin.

After a couple of miscues the John Dee Medal of Medals was played on Sunday in perfect an conditions.

Rhys Farrell is another player in great form and after returning a sizzling four under off the stick collected the prize. Farrell plays off one and should reduce that even further following his hot performance. He finished the round five shots ahead of runner up Andrew Collins. Peter Gribbin was the winner of the B Division Medal.

We done to both winners. The club extends a big thank you to John Dee for their yearly support of this event.
